As many of you know I have enjoyed running on and off for several years. After a four year break 2012 was a turning point, I either continued to gather middle age spread or I took control and focused on staying healthy and fit. After losing nearly 2 stone I began to enjoy running once again and achieved personal best times in 5k, 5 miles,10k and half marathon events.

Working as a palliative care nurse at QA hospital I  have very close links with the Rowans hospice and see first hand the many good works they achieve in caring for palliative patients and their families. Details of the many wonderful services they offer can be found on their website www.rowanshospice.co.uk

My goal for 2013 is to beat my peronal best times in all distances through either club races or official events and raise as much money as possible for this very worthy cause. 

Best times up to 2012

5k - 24.35 - February 2012 - GRR club time trial

5m - 40.23 - May 2012 - GRR club time trial

10k - 52.24 - Dec 2012 - GRR club handicap

10m - 1.29.46 - Oct 2008 - Great South Run

1/2 marathon - 1.54.43 - Nov 2012 - GRR helpers half 

Full marathon - 4.36.54 - Oct 2007 - New Forest marathon

I have already entered several events this year culminating in The Portsmouth Marathon in December. Your donations and support will be hugely appreciated!

About the charity

The Rowans Hospice

Verified by JustGiving

RCN 299731
Rowans Hospice provides end of life care across South East Hampshire. We help improve quality of life for the patient around the clock. We receive a very small level of Government support and almost all of the money required to provide our services needs to be raised through voluntary giving.
